Streamflow
Streamflow forecasts are below average as of April 1. Deerfield
Reservoir inflow is forecast at 2,500 acre feet (60 percent of
average). Pactola is forecast at 10,000 acre feet (53 percent of
average). This is for the April - July runoff period.

The average is computed for the 1961-1990 base period. (1) - The values listed under the 10% and 90% Chance of Exceeding are actually 5% and 95% exceedance levels. (2) - The value is natural volume - actual volume may be affected by upstream water management.
